Family Group Connections
The parent meetings of the past are gone......now we are having Family Group Connections!
These meetings are designed to connect families with the school, especially your child's teacher and classroom! The mission of Asheboro City Schools is to provide high quality learning opportunities for all students in a safe and inviting environment so that our students can become successful lifelong learners, prepared for 21st century global citizenship. The school system's vision is to see every student graduate.
Research shows that parent participation in a child's education, including school involvement is a key factor in the child's educational success. We want to help you continue your child's learning experience outside the classroom. We plan to share information on child development, how children learn through play, how important it is to read with your child and many other interesting topics. We are also here to answer your questions and connect you with the many resources available within our community!
These meetings are also an excellent opportunity to connect with other parents!

We hold one group connection meeting each month at each Pre-k location. Every family is encouraged to attend!
